👻 New Deceptive Minds issue: Cognitive Heist series issue #4 -- The Ghost

The ghost doesn’t break in. It doesn’t even exist. It just panics you into acting-- fast, unthinking, exposed.

This issue explores one of the most dangerous tools in a scammer’s toolkit: urgency. We unpack:

🧠 The psychology of panic and why urgency shuts down critical thinking

📞 Real-world scams that weaponize fake emergencies

🕯️ A chilling tie-in to folklore: the crying child at the door

🐙 And yes, there are tentacles. Always tentacles.

The Ghost's superpower is tricking you into moving before you think.
